Heading to Boston for solo travel? You want to check out the Artist Tower rooms at the Omni Boston Hotel at the Seaport has designed a different (and less expensive!) experience for your vacation or work travel. These unique rooms are smaller but designed in a really smart way. Check out the @omnibostonhotelattheseaport options - and note that you get "fancy" coffee that's more than just the standard black coffee pods in your hotel room. This room tour shows the king bed option. There is also a ONE queen bed option, but note that there are no Artist Tower rooms with two beds. You have to go to the Patreon Tower with the more spacious rooms if you want to not share a bed with someone.
